The Department of Cardiology at Apollo Adlux Hospital, Kochi, provides evaluation, medical management and long-term follow-up for a broad range of heart conditions. Our cardiologists use clinical assessment, non-invasive cardiac testing and advanced imaging to develop an individualised treatment plan for each patient. The Cardiology division at Apollo Adlux Hospital specialises in the diagnosis, medical management, and long-term care of all forms of heart disease. Our DM (Cardiology) qualified consultants are experienced in treating a wide range of cardiac conditions using the latest diagnostic technologies and treatment protocols

When a patient requires a catheter-based procedure, surgery or structured rehabilitation, the cardiology team works closely with Interventional Cardiology, Cardiothoracic and Vascular Surgery, Cardiac Anaesthesia and Cardiac Rehabilitation to ensure continuity of care. Consult a cardiologist if you have chest pain or tightness, shortness of breath, palpitations, unexplained fatigue, dizziness, fainting or swelling of the feet and ankles. A consultation is also advisable if you have diabetes, high blood pressure, high cholesterol, obesity, a smoking history or a family history of heart disease.

Depending on your symptoms and risk factors, the cardiologist may recommend an ECG, echocardiogram, Holter monitoring, treadmill test, stress echocardiography or CT coronary angiography. Invasive coronary angiography may be advised when clinically appropriate.

No. Many heart conditions can be managed with medicines, lifestyle changes and regular follow-up. Procedures are recommended only after clinical assessment and relevant tests.
